Lazio 4-1 Spal: report, ratings and highlights

Lazio vs Spal finished 4-1 to the Biancocelesti as two goals from Ciro Immobile and impressive long-range efforts from midfielders Danilo Cataldi and Marco Parolo gave Simone Inzaghi’s side a big three points at the Stadio Olimpico. The team put defeat against Inter Milan behind them and focused on the task at hand, extending Lazio’s impressive 100% record against teams outside of the big six.

Lazio opened the scoring in the 26th minute after a pass from Danilo Cataldi found Ciro Immobile, who put the ball in the back of the net. Spal promptly equalised in the 28th minute with Mirco Antenucci after a whipped cross from Lazio target Manuel Lazzari. It didn’t take long for Inzaghi’s side to take the lead again, when, in the 35th minute, good build-up play from Felipe Caicedo gave Ciro Immobile a chance to score his second, which the Italian took with ease.

The second half was much easier for Lazio, who played extremely well to give Spal no way back into the match. The Biancocelesti pinged the ball around with ease, bringing back the fast attacking football that made the team so entertaining to watch last campaign. In the 59th minute, Danilo Cataldi scored a beautiful goal from outside the box after winning the ball back in dangerous territory. Marco Parolo then scored a similar goal in the 70th minute.

Inzaghi recovered from the defeat to Inter Milan in the best way possible as Lazio now look ahead to games against Marseille and Sassuolo, before the international break takes place. Lazio sit in 4th place in Serie A after Lazio vs Spal, four points off of 3rd place Napoli and three points above AC Milan in 5th, with the Rossoneri yet to play their game in hand, which takes place against Udinese this evening.

Lazio vs Spal Player Ratings:

Strakosha 6.5 – The Albanian had a quiet game in goal for Lazio, with little in the way of tests. There was not much he could’ve done to prevent Spal’s only goal.

Radu 7 – Business as usual for the newly extended Romanian, had a couple of minor lapses in focus but overall played well.

Acerbi 7.5 – Strong performance in defence from the experienced Italian – helped organise the defence and turnover possession.

Wallace 7.5 – Once again showed the makings of a quality defender.

Lulic 7 – Caught in no man’s land for the Spal goal, Lulic was strong going forward but failed to offer much in the way of defensive assistance on Spal’s few attacks.

Milinkovic-Savic 7 – Starting to look more like the Sergej we remember, the Serb is still nowhere near his full capacity. Faced his brother in goal today and had plenty of efforts on target, yet failed to find the net.

Cataldi 8.5 – Stepped into the midfield and looked like he had been playing there for years. Scored an excellent goal, provided an assist for Immobile’s first and was one of the star performers on the field.

Parolo 8 – Scored a fantastic goal to round-off a strong performance.

Patric 7.5 – The Spaniard once again played well at right wing-back, delivering an offensive and defensive threat for Lazio.

Caicedo 7.5 – The Ecuadorian put a disappointing performance against Inter Milan behind him to offer good support for Immobile and provided the assist for Ciro’s second.

Immobile 8.5 – Two goals speaks volumes but perhaps he should have had more. Was nearly at his best, instinctively finding space and creating opportunities throughout.
